Output 86fa4805f26f14923d319f8ff0026070b76aea0074b2d76175b23b35103e9dc5:3

value
113575228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db25d71663080ee6eaf36d919c1eaaa9da425146 OP_EQUAL
address
MTsuYd6mSUgkztfd2Lhxd4QyuyatMju13A
transaction
86fa4805f26f14923d319f8ff0026070b76aea0074b2d76175b23b35103e9dc5
spent
true